One of the most frequent hurdles for French shoppers is the payment wall. Many major US retailers, including those selling the latest Kindle models or high-demand items from Apple and Sephora, often block international credit cards. Even if your card is valid, orders are frequently declined if the billing address does not match a US domestic profile. Furthermore, some stores automatically cancel orders sent to known forward packages addresses if they detect a foreign payment source.

The solution to this problem is the comGateway BuyForMe service. This assisted purchase program means comGateway buys the item on your behalf using a US domestic credit card and a localized billing profile. This effectively eliminates the risk of order cancellation due to payment discrepancies. Customs and Import Duties for French Residents

Shipping electronics into France requires an understanding of the local customs landscape. Since you are importing from outside the European Union, your package will be subject to French VAT (typically 20%). However, because the Kindle is a relatively small and lightweight device, the international shipping rates are often quite competitive, making the total expense manageable.

When you shop US store locations, remember that you are responsible for these import fees upon the package's arrival in France. Using a reputable parcel forwarding service ensures that all necessary documentation is correctly filed, which minimizes delays at the border.
